Automate supported migration steps, review what needs attention, and plan your cutover before moving production traffic.
Start with your source, workloads and dependencies. Supported Kubernetes imports can inventory resources; other sources may need an export or manual setup.
Review compatibility, required conversions and a target estimate. Proprietary services and unsupported resources need a separate plan.
Use the supported migration workflow, test the target and agree on a cutover window. Downtime and rollback depend on your workload.

No single migration path covers every workload. Supported Kubernetes imports can inventory resources, and the console includes a PostgreSQL migration flow. Some environments require supplied inventory, exports or redeployment. Proprietary APIs and platform-specific features need separate review. The selector above is a planning guide—not a completed compatibility scan.
We don't promise zero downtime. Data size, write activity, network access, source capabilities and your application's dependencies affect the migration. Validate the target, take appropriate backups, establish a rollback plan and approve a cutover window before changing production traffic.
